Ben Mankiewicz

IN 2024, THE BELOVED CABLE CHANNEL TURNER CLASSIC MOVIES WILL turn 30, and for host Ben Mankiewicz-who recently celebrated his 20th anniversary at the helm-he still feels "so unbelievably fortunate to be associated with the channel." It's one of those rare networks where "it's a little bit part of your identity" and "the only channel where the channel itself matters to people." Part of the network's charm is that it taps into nostalgia. "Nostalgia is a really powerful and important emotion. It is the emotion that connects us to our past.
